Restorative Ecology and Conservation Practices
Ecological restoration aims to rejuvenate damaged ecosystems, returning them to a healthier and more functional state. This process involves various strategies, such as habitat recreation, species population augmentation, and the control of invasive species. Conservation strategies focus on preserving existing ecosystems and biodiversity through methods like protected reserves, sustainable resource management, and public awareness initiatives. By combining restoration and conservation efforts, we can effectively mitigate the impacts of human activity and promote a more sustainable future.

Integrating Sustainable Urban Systems: Green Infrastructure Planning and Application
Successful deployment of green infrastructure solutions relies on a thorough design process that evaluates various factors. This includes ecological principles, site-specific conditions, community needs, and long-term resiliency. A robust design framework should champion multi-functional benefits, such as minimizing stormwater runoff, enhancing air quality, and providing habitat for local flora and fauna. Furthermore, effective green infrastructure projects demand meaningful community engagement throughout the entire process, from initial planning to ongoing maintenance.
- Key components of a successful green infrastructure implementation include:
- Vegetated rooftops
- Bioswales
- Porous surfaces
- Urban forests
Combating Climate Change: A Plan for Mitigation and Adaptation
Effective strategies to combat climate change require a comprehensive system that encompasses both mitigation and adaptation. Mitigation efforts concentrate on reducing greenhouse gas emissions through transitioning to renewable energy sources, improving energy efficiency, and implementing sustainable land use practices. In parallel, adaptation measures aim to enhance resilience to read more the inevitable impacts of climate change that are already being witnessed. This may involve putting funds towards infrastructure upgrades, developing early warning systems for extreme weather events, and promoting resilient agricultural practices. A successful climate action plan must integrate these mitigation and adaptation methodologies to create a more sustainable and resilient future.
